A rock has been dropped from a height of 64 ft.
Height of the rock is determined after time 't' by the expression.
S(t) = -16t² + 64
Where 0 ≤ + ≤ 2
Total distance traveled by the rock in
2 seconds = 64 feet
Therefore average velocity = = 32 ft per second
The average velocity of the rock would be 32 ft per second.
